Genesis 14:17-20

17 Und als er zurückgekehrt war, nachdem er Kedorlaomer und die Könige, die mit ihm gewesen, geschlagen hatte, zog der König von Sodom aus, ihm entgegen, in das Tal Schawe, das ist das Königstal.
18 Und Melchisedek, König von Salem, brachte Brot und Wein heraus; und er war Priester Gottes, des Höchsten.
19 Und er segnete ihn und sprach: Gesegnet sei Abram von Gott, dem Höchsten, der Himmel und Erde besitzt!
20 Und gepriesen sei Gott, der Höchste, der deine Feinde in deine Hand geliefert hat! Und Abram gab ihm den Zehnten von allem.

INTRODUCTION TO GENESIS 14

This chapter gives an account of a war that was waged, and a battle fought between four kings on one side, and five on the other, and of the occasion and issue of it, who were the first kings, and this the first battle the Scriptures speak of, Ge 14:1-11; Lot and his goods being taken and carried off, with those of Sodom, by the conquerors, Abram hearing of it armed his men, and pursued after them, and overtook and overcame them, and rescued Lot and his goods, with others, and returned, Ge 14:12-16; when he was met by the kings of Sodom and Salem, who congratulated him on his victory, Ge 14:17-19; and what passed between him, and those great personages, is related, Ge 14:20-24.
